How Finnegan Helped Transform a Life and a Community

by Doreen Miller

When Nina Romain adopted Finnegan, a young American Staffordshire from Dogwatch Sanctuary Trust, she thought she was firmly a cat person. That all changed the day she met the spirited pup who would transform her life.

Romain and her dog Finnegan are now proudly participating in Raise the Woof, Dogwatch Sanctuary Trust’s annual fundraiser throughout May. The initiative invites participants to log their dog walks or distance covered via personal fundraising pages, raising vital funds to support abandoned and neglected dogs.

Last year, Romain and her partner Felix finished among the top participants, tallying an impressive 350km alongside Finnegan. This year, they plan to surpass 100km without breaking a sweat. “He gets walked every day, so it’s easy,” Romain said.

Their journey together began when Romain and Felix, seeking a dog that would get along with their cat June, adopted Finnegan — then just a three-week-old “tiny little nugget.” Since moving to New Zealand from France in 2021, Romain says Finnegan has opened up a whole new world for her.

“He’s changed our lives for the better,” she said. “He’s a friendly, cuddly dog who’s made me more active and helped me discover Christchurch. He’s such a joy to have.”

Inspired by the bond they formed, Romain has since become a volunteer — and now a casual staff member — at Dogwatch Sanctuary Trust. “I know now that I want to work with dogs,” she said.

Dogwatch’s general manager, Bridget Paterson, said the enthusiasm from last year’s participants has motivated them to expand the event. “People walked, ran, and hiked with their dogs — all to help the dogs in our care,” Paterson said. “This year, we’re making it even more special by introducing a public dog walk, giving the community a chance to come together and show their support.”

The community walk is scheduled for Saturday, May 31, starting at Medway Bridge on River Rd/Avonside Drive, in Christchurch’s red zone. Well-behaved dogs on leads are welcome to join.

Every dollar raised through Raise the Woof directly supports Dogwatch’s mission to rescue, rehabilitate, and rehome dogs in need — and this year, contributions will go even further. Calder Stewart, the event’s official matching sponsor, will match donations dollar for dollar, effectively doubling the impact.

Participants walk for many reasons: to honor the memory of a beloved pet, to celebrate the bond they share with their current companions, or simply to help dogs still waiting for their forever homes.

“It’s thanks to fundraisers like this that we can give these dogs the love, training, and care they need to thrive,” Paterson said.
